  • CUNY Open Data Takeover at NYC PIT Pop Up

    From March 23–27th 2026, CUNY PIT Lab will be showcasing a week of workshops, demonstrations, and interactive presentations at NYC PIT Pop Up as part of Open Data Week!

    For the past decade, New Yorkers have come together across the five boroughs each March to celebrate public data in New York City and mark the anniversary of the City’s first open data law. Co-organized and presented by NYC Open Data Team at the Office of Technology and Innovation (OTI), BetaNYC, and Data Through Design, Open Data Week is an opportunity for New Yorkers to better understand their city through the work being done by NYC’s civic tech and open data communities.

    As NYC PIT Pop Up continues to showcase how technology can serve the public good at its location in the South Concourse of the iconic Oculus/World Trade Center, Open Data Week will serve as the space’s second major activation  following its successful eleven-day launch in fall of 2025. During this week, projects from CUNY as well as the wider PIT community will be shared through interactive demos, data visualizations, and short, plain-language explanations designed for non-expert audiences, while remaining meaningful for practitioners and policymakers.

    In addition to featured demos, the space will function as a collaborative open data studio, where project teams can troubleshoot works-in-progress, receive feedback on data storytelling and visualization, and offer mini-demos of open tools that support open data research and communication.
